Job Description

Oliver James are partnered with a specialist Deals Advisory firm to support in their hiring of a a Technology Advisory Manager. The role will be London based, averaging 3 days in the office, paying up to c£100,000 basic excluding a car allowance, bonuses, well-being allowances and flexible benefits. As a Manager, you would operate under tight M&A time frames and demands; interfacing with corporate technology teams, CIOs, CTOs, CISOs and Private Equity investment teams to support successful execution of their M&A engagements. You will be advising clients, PE firms and other enterprises across technology pre-deal diligence, carve-outs, integrations and portfolio reviews. Advice could be across a number of initiatives, including:- End to end technology due diligence; Carve out complexity; Separation & integration strategies; Transformation planning.
